Learning Excellence in
Partnership
This expresses
the essence of the Institute's
philosophy of learning and
teaching. Good learning takes
place when an effective
partnership is created between
learners and teachers. Learners
and teachers have
responsibilities to each other,
as well as to themselves.
iIT
is committed to offering
high-quality lifelong learning
together with flexible and
innovative delivery that
respects diversity and promotes
excellence.
Breadth of Quality
Programs:
The Institute will
prepare students to
become leading
technology
professionals by
enhancing their
abilities in
critical thinking
and creativity, and
instilling life long
learning as an
essential part of
their maintaining
and improving
professional
competence.
Graduates will be
prepared to support
and drive the growth
of the Philippine
technology industry.
The Institute will
enhance its efforts
to provide broad
access coupled with
a high retention
rate. The result
will be an abundant
number of highly
qualified technology
bachelor's and
master's level
graduates. The
Institute will also
provide high quality
technology related
courses for students
in other academic
programs, and for a
broad range of
practicing
professionals.
Professional
Currency:
Provide appealing
education
opportunities for
practicing high-tech
professionals
designed to maintain
their currency and
competitiveness, to
enhance career paths
and mobility, and to
provide
opportunities to
pursue more advanced
educational degrees
and credentials. The
Institute will
provide a spectrum
of options -
enrollment in a
formal bachelor and
masters degree
program in
collaboration with
the Graduate School,
highly specialized
courses, and
enrollment in
certification
courses that has
worldwide
recognition.
Industry/Community
Partnerships:
Create partnerships
with IT industry
leaders (Local and
International) and
IT local Community
to provide an
environment of
challenging and
rewarding
experiences and
opportunities for
students, and of
technology transfer
and economic
development derived
from on faculty and
collaborative
research. Practicing
professionals will
join the faculty as
part time lecturers
to teach targeted
concentration
courses, and to
bring unique
expertise,
experience, and
professional
practicing
perspective to the
program.
Student Retention:
Develop programs and
support structures
to promote the
highest levels of
student retention.
Academic evaluation
of incoming students
will ensure that
students? initial
programs are adapted
to best serve their
individual needs. An
emphasis will be
placed upon creating
opportunities for
students to become
effective members
appropriate learning
cohorts. The
Institute will place
a particular
emphasis on creating
and maintaining
environments
conducive to the
success of these
students.
Pipeline of
Well-Prepared
Students:
Collaborate with IT
industry leaders and
certification
authorities to
ensure academic
programs respond to
the rapidly
accelerating pace of
change in technology
and global
competitiveness. The
Institute will offer
a broad academic
program, including
strength in systems
development,
networking, project
management, digital
arts, mobile
computing,
e-commerce, and the
likes. The Institute
will continuously
collaborate with
industry leaders to
evaluate and
determine industry
need that is
critical in
educational
preparation.
People Empowerment:
The Institute will
initiate up-to-date
technology learning
changes reflected in
ICT Integration
Programs both for
teaching and
non-teaching
personnel. This is
to ensure that the
Colegio's personnel
are empowered with
the necessary
knowledge and skills
when it comes to the
use of technology in
teaching, learning,
research, management
and delivery of
administrative
services.
